What's My Name, Fool? is a charged collection of brief, straight-talk essays about racism, politics, athletes and sports in American history. From the story Muhammad Ali, who refused participation in the Vietnam War and was stripped of his title for it, to the exploited death of Pat Tillman, who refused to be used as a propaganda symbol for America's wars in life but proved to be far more pliable in death ...
